When Fernwheel's p95 template render time exceeds 400ms for ten consecutive minutes, the Ashgrove pager fires. First, check whether the partial cache was invalidated by a recent deploy; a cold cache self-heals within fifteen minutes and needs no escalation. If latency persists with a warm cache, capture a flame graph from the render profiler and attach the three worst template paths. Do not restart the render pool without approval from the platform lead. With the flame graph in hand, escalate by writing to the address below.

pager mailbox: silael.sorwyn.tamius@zemvarsys.corp

### Step 4: Slim the image

The Pellgrove build uses a two-stage Dockerfile; the final stage copies only the compiled binary and CA bundle, dropping the toolchain entirely. Verify the resulting image contains no shell or package manager before pushing to the Harlowe registry. The runtime reads configuration from `/run/env/app.env`; after the standard flags, the registry pull token is set on the following line.

env line for fafof-fahag: LEDGER_TOKEN5=f8790

## v2.14.0 — Blue-Green Deploys for Billing Worker

The Tallyglass billing worker now ships via blue-green deploys. Traffic flips only after the green pool passes invoice-reconciliation smoke checks, and rollback is a single switch, no data migration involved. Security reviewers: secrets are mounted per-pool, never shared across colors. Deploy approvals and incident rollbacks for this pipeline go through the owner named below.

named custodian: Briir Druir Aldmir